Score 16.5/20 · Drink 2005-2025, Jancis Robinson MW, Oct 2013
Much deeper and more vigorous colour than the regular 1987. Smudgy pale rim. Smells quite intense and intriguing but as though not all of the grapes were fully ripe. On the palate there is some strawberry jam and definite concentration though none of the really wild notes that characterise Nacional at its best. A bit stolid for a Nacional. Still a bit of tannin but a hint of spirit too. (JR)
